The Department of Naval Architecture and Ocean Engineering, Graduate School of Engineering, The University of Osaka, is seeking a postdoctoral researcher (Specially Appointed Researcher) to develop a digital twin framework for wind turbine blade monitoring using optical fiber sensors bonded to the blade surface.
This position is funded by a joint industry project (JIP) supported by multiple industry partners.
Research focus
Integrating optical fiber sensing, signal processing, structural modeling, data assimilation, and machine learning to support reliable wind turbine blade condition monitoring.
Responsibilities#
- Develop a sensing system using optical fiber sensors bonded to wind turbine blades.
- Develop a digital twin framework for blade condition monitoring based on sensor data, including signal processing, structural modeling, data assimilation, and machine learning.
- Plan and conduct wind tunnel tests for experimental validation.
- Prepare academic papers and present research results at conferences.
- Undertake other duties necessary for carrying out the research project.
Qualifications#
- A Ph.D. degree obtained by the start of employment, or expected to be obtained by that time.
- Knowledge of and research experience in one or more of the following fields is preferred: structural health monitoring; wind engineering or fluid-structure interaction; digital twins; machine learning or data assimilation; and asset management engineering.
- Experience with data processing and numerical analysis using programming languages such as Python or MATLAB is preferred.
- Ability to independently plan and conduct experiments, including wind tunnel tests.
